Output 58930d5412f2268b78cd03ff01492724c84346360e5dbf60cd0ebb7e98e8afeb:0

value
375390876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10feef33835025e6534778e8e9ce68dc4b993764 OP_EQUAL
address
33Et8mHHoFcFDZhkoq3oQtDUJHuKhLXuqo
transaction
58930d5412f2268b78cd03ff01492724c84346360e5dbf60cd0ebb7e98e8afeb
spent
true